The Problem of Induction and the Uniformity of Nature

Quick fact

David Hume introduced this problem in the 18th century, showing that all inductive inferences rely on the unprovable assumption that the future will resemble the past.

Why this is interesting

You trust that the sun will rise tomorrow because it always has. But what justifies that trust?
